Which of the following sets of forces acting
simultaneously on a particle keep it in
equilibrium?
1) 3N, 5N, 10N 2) 4N, 7N, 12N
3) 2N, 6N, 5N 4) 5N, 8N, IN

Answers

Answered by abhi178
31

answer : option (3) 2N,6N,5N

explanation : given forces should follows condition : sum of any two forces is greater than or equal to third force and also difference of two forces is less than or equal to third force.

mathematically,

if we assume F_1, F_2 and F_3 are three force applied on a particle.

at equilibrium,

|F_1-F_2|\leq F_3\leq |F_1+F_2|

|F_2-F_3|\leq F_1\leq |F_2+F_3|

|F_3-F_1|\leq F_2\leq |F_3+F_1|

here, only option (3) follows above condition.

|6 - 2| < 4 < |6 + 2| , |4 - 2| < 6 ≤ |4 + 2| and |6 - 4| ≤ 2 < |6 + 4|

so, option (3) is correct
